The 2026 Automation Study from Peerless Research Group and Modern Materials Handling, published around July 27, 2026, provides detailed insights into how warehouse and distribution center operations are approaching automation investments and technology evaluation. Drawing from responses of more than 120 professionals involved in purchasing decisions, the study covers facilities spanning food and beverage, electrical equipment, chemicals, pharmaceuticals, aerospace, and other sectors, with average facility size around 137,000 square feet and average employment of about 1,095 people. Current full automation levels remain relatively low across core processes: labeling reaches 24 percent, reporting 18 percent, packaging 13 percent, picking 12 percent, storage 11 percent, conveyance 10 percent, and replenishment 9 percent, while retrieval stands at only 3 percent.

Significant portions of operations still rely on mostly or fully manual processes for picking, retrieval, storage, and packaging, though partial automation is more common in conveyance, replenishment, and retrieval. Equipment adoption shows stronger traction. Nearly half of respondents already use conveyor and sortation systems, with a similar share planning implementations or upgrades within two years; goods-to-person picking solutions follow almost identical current-use and planned-adoption patterns.

Weighing, cubing, and dimensioning equipment, pocket sortation, automated packaging, automated storage systems including mini-loads and AS/RS, automatic guided vehicles, and palletizing robotics all show solid current penetration and even higher intent for near-term expansion. Buyers prioritize durability, reliability, and uptime (92 percent rating these very important), followed closely by fast service response times (95 percent), total cost of ownership and ROI considerations, parts availability, integration and compatibility with existing systems, and scalability. Key drivers for investment include the need to meet faster order fulfillment SLAs, competitive pressure from peers already automating, support for new go-to-market strategies, and ongoing difficulty recruiting and retaining reliable warehouse labor.

Software forms the connective tissue: warehouse management systems lead at 57 percent adoption, followed by parcel rating tools, labor management systems, computerized maintenance management systems, warehouse control systems, transportation management systems, warehouse execution systems, slotting software, and yard management systems. Planned upgrades over the next 24 months focus especially on yard management, slotting, WES, and CMMS. Average planned spending on materials handling equipment and solutions for 2026 rises to approximately $1.6 million from $1.5 million the prior year, with a wide distribution across budget brackets and roughly one-third of companies expecting increases.

Overall the study portrays an industry moving from isolated pilots toward broader, more integrated automation while still navigating uneven adoption and economic caution.
